ChangeHorse
Description: This plugin allows you to change the color, style, and type of the horse you are riding. You must be riding the horse you want to change, and you must have the appropriate permission if using a permissions system. /ChangeHorse is the command. Entering the command with no arguments will give you the available parameters. The characteristics available to change at the moment are the color of a normal horse, the type of horse, and the pattern or style of the horse if it is normal.
====== Commands/Permissions ======
Note: /chs is an alternative for /ChangeHorse, t is a short argument for Type. c is short for Color, st is a short argument for Style, js is short for JumpStrength, and mh is short for MaxHealth.
Use: Tame your horse/donkey/mule, then while riding them use one of the above commands.
Source: https://github.com/st392/ChangeHorse/
Metrics
This plugin utilises Hidendra's plugin metrics system, which means that the following information is collected and sent to mcstats.org:
- A unique identifier
- The server's version of Java
- Whether the server is in offline or online mode
- The plugin's version
- The server's version
- The OS version/name and architecture
- The core count for the CPU
- The number of players online
- The Metrics version If you wish to disable this feature, you can do so by opt-ing out, which you can do in the config file under /plugins/PluginMetrics/
Auto-Updater
This plugin has a built-in auto-updater, which connects to BukkitDev to check for updates. If you, for some reason, wish to disable this process, you can disable just the update download by setting doUpdate to false in the plugins' configuration. Or you can disable the update checking and downloading all together by setting checkUpdate to false in the plugins' configuration
